DALLAS-A recognized pro of the capital markets has a bit ofadvice for the nation: stop mistreating the money source or itmight go away.

The words of caution came from Luis Belmonte, principal of theSan Francisco-based Seven Hills Properties, who was the keynotespeaker at yesterday's NAIOP awards event for the region's topoffice and industrial brokers of the year. Pocketing the wins wereGary Collett, senior director in Cushman & Wakefield of TexasInc.'s industrial division, and colleague, Michael S. Wyatt, anexecutive director focused on office who also recently won theprestigious Stemmons Award from the North Texas CommercialAssociation of Realtors.
